linux下tar打包部分文件
时间: 2024-02-20 09:49:33 浏览: 24
在 下使用 tar 命令打包部分文件,可以通过在命令后面指定需要打包的文件或目录的路径来实现。具体操作可以参考以下命令:
打包单个文件:
```
tar -czvf file.tar.gz /path/to/file
```
打包多个文件:
```
tar -czvf files.tar.gz /path/to/file1 /path/to/file2 /path/to/file3
```
打包整个目录:
```
tar -czvf dir.tar.gz /path/to/dir
```
打包目录下的部分文件:
```
tar -czvf dir_files.tar.gz /path/to/dir/file1 /path/to/dir/file2 /path/to/dir/file3
```
其中,选项说明:
- `-c`:表示创建打包文件。
- `-z`:表示使用 gzip 压缩算法。
- `-v`:表示打包过程中显示详细信息。
- `-f`:表示指定打包后的文件名。
相关问题
linux打包tar文件
要在 Linux 系统中打包 tar 文件,可以使用 tar 命令。以下是打包的基本语法:
```
tar -cvf <打包文件名.tar> <要打包的文件或目录>
```
其中,选项说明如下:
- `-c`:创建新的 tar 文件。
- `-v`:显示打包过程中的详细信息(可选)。
- `-f`:指定打包文件名。
例如,要将 `/home/user/docs` 目录打包成 `docs.tar` 文件,可以使用以下命令:
```
tar -cvf docs.tar /home/user/docs
```
注意,在打包文件名后面不需要加上 `.tar` 后缀,因为 `-f` 选项已经指定了打包文件名。
如果要将多个文件或目录打包成一个 tar 文件,可以在命令行中列出它们的路径:
```
tar -cvf archive.tar file1.txt file2.txt dir1 dir2
```
以上命令将打包 `file1.txt`、`file2.txt`、`dir1` 和 `dir2`,并将它们保存在 `archive.tar` 文件中。
头歌实践教学平台linux文件tar打包命令
以下是Linux文件tar打包命令的示例:
```shell
tar -cvf test.tar /home/test
```
其中,test.tar是打包后的文件名,/home/test是要打包的文件路径。如果要将打包文件压缩成gzip格式,可以使用以下命令:
```shell
tar -czvf test.tar.gz /home/test
```
其中,test.tar.gz是压缩后的文件名。如果要查看已经打包的文件内容,可以使用以下命令:
```shell
tar -tvf test.tar
```
其中,test.tar是已经打包的文件名。如果要解压已经压缩的文件,可以使用以下命令:
```shell
tar -xzvf test.tar.gz
```
其中,test.tar.gz是已经压缩的文件名。